McLaren M2B
The McLaren M2B was the McLaren team's first Formula One racing car, used during the 1966 season. It was conceived in 1965 and preceded by the M2A development car. Designed by Robin Herd, the innovative but problematic Mallite material was used in its construction. The car was powered by Ford and Serenissima engines but both lacked power and suffered from reliability issues. Driven by team founder Bruce McLaren, the M2B had a short Grand Prix career, entering six races and starting only four. It scored the team's first point at the and two more points at the . Background and development Bruce McLaren Motor Racing was founded in 1963; Bruce McLaren was a factory driver for the Cooper motor racing team which competed in Formula One, the highest level of international single-seater competition. Open Wheel Car
An open-wheel single-seater (often known as formula car) is a car with the wheels outside the car's main body, and usually having only one seat. Open-wheel cars contrast with street cars, sports cars, stock cars, and touring cars, which have their wheels below the body or inside fenders. Open-wheel cars are built both for road racing and oval track racing. Street-legal open-wheel cars, such as the Ariel Atom, are scarce as they are often impractical for everyday use. History American racecar driver and constructor Ray Harroun was an early pioneer of the concept of a lightweight single-seater, open-wheel "monoposto" racecar. After working as a mechanic in the automotive industry, Harroun began competitive professional racing in 1906, winning the AAA National Championship in 1910. He was then hired by the Marmon Motor Car Company as chief engineer, charged with building a racecar intended to race at the first Indianapolis 500, which he went on to win. Cooper Car Company
The Cooper Car Company is a British car manufacturer founded in December 1947 by Charles Cooper and his son John Cooper. Together with John's boyhood friend, Eric Brandon, they began by building racing cars in Charles's small garage in Surbiton, Surrey, England, in 1946. Through the 1950s and early 1960s they reached motor racing's highest levels as their mid-engined, single-seat cars competed in both Formula One and the Indianapolis 500, and their Mini Cooper dominated rally racing. The Cooper name lives on in the Cooper versions of the Mini production cars that are built in England, but is now owned and marketed by BMW. Origins The first cars built by the Coopers were single-seat 500-cc Formula Three racing cars driven by John Cooper and Eric Brandon, and powered by a JAP motorcycle engine. Factory-backed
In motorsports, a factory-backed racing team or driver is one sponsored by a vehicle manufacturer in official competitions. As motorsport competition is an expensive endeavor, some degree of factory support is desired and often necessary for success. The lowest form of factory backing comes in the form of contingency awards, based upon performance, which help to defray the cost of competing. Full factory backing can be often seen in the highest forms of international competition, with major motorsport operations often receiving hundreds of millions of euros to represent a particular manufacturer. One-make series can also be backed by the factory, notably Ferrari Challenge and Porsche Supercup purely to allow themselves sell their competition specials of their models to customers and to organize series. 1966 Formula One Season
The 1966 Formula One season was the 20th season of FIA Formula One motor racing. It featured the 1966 World Championship of Drivers and the 1966 International Cup for F1 Manufacturers1974 FIA Yearbook, Grey section, pages 120–121 which were contested concurrently over a nine-race series that commenced on 22 May and ended on 23 October. The season saw the "return to power" with the introduction of the '3 litre formula', doubling maximum engine capacity from 1.5 litres. Jack Brabham won the World Championship of Drivers and Brabham-Repco was awarded the International Cup for F1 Manufacturers. The season also included a number of non-championship races for Formula One cars. Championship summary The season was the first of the '3 litre formula', which saw maximum engine capacity doubled from the previous season. 1966 Monaco Grand Prix
The 1966 Monaco Grand Prix was a Formula One motor race held at the Circuit de Monaco on 22 May 1966. It was race 1 of 9 in both the 1966 World Championship of Drivers and the 1966 International Cup for Formula One Manufacturers. The race was the first World Championship event of a new era for Formula One, for which engine regulations were altered from 1.5 litres of maximum engine displacement to 3.0 litres. The race was the 24th Monaco Grand Prix. The race was won by British driver Jackie Stewart driving a BRM P261. He took a forty-second victory over the Ferrari 246 of Italian driver Lorenzo Bandini. It was Stewart's second Grand Prix victory after winning the Italian Grand Prix the previous year. Stewart's team-mate, fellow Briton Graham Hill finished a lap down in third position in his BRM P261. Firestone Tire And Rubber Company
Firestone Tire and Rubber Company is a tire company founded by Harvey Firestone (1868–1938) in 1900 initially to supply solid rubber side-wire tires for fire apparatus, and later, pneumatic tires for wagons, buggies, and other forms of wheeled transportation common in the era. Firestone soon saw the huge potential for marketing tires for automobiles, and the company was a pioneer in the mass production of tires. Harvey Firestone had a personal friendship with Henry Ford, and used this to become the original equipment supplier of Ford Motor Company automobiles, and was also active in the replacement market. In 1988, the company was sold to the Japanese Bridgestone Corporation. History Early-to-mid-20th century Firestone was originally based in Akron, Ohio, also the hometown of its archrival, Goodyear, and two other midsized competitors, General Tire and Rubber and BFGoodrich. Transaxle
A transaxle is a single mechanical device which combines the functions of an automobile's transmission, axle, and differential into one integrated assembly. It can be produced in both manual and automatic versions. Engine and drive at the same end Transaxles are nearly universal in all automobile configurations that have the engine placed at the same end of the car as the driven wheels: the front-engine/front-wheel-drive; rear-engine/rear-wheel-drive; and mid-engine/rear-wheel-drive arrangements. Many mid- and rear-engined vehicles use a transverse engine and transaxle, similar to a front-wheel-drive unit. Others use a longitudinal engine and transaxle like Ferrari's 1989 Mondial t which used a "T" arrangement with a longitudinal engine connected to a transverse transaxle. Manual Gearbox
A manual transmission (MT), also known as manual gearbox, standard transmission (in Canada, the United Kingdom, and the United States), or stick shift (in the United States), is a multi-speed motor vehicle transmission system, where gear changes require the driver to manually select the gears by operating a gear stick and clutch (which is usually a foot pedal for cars or a hand lever for motorcycles). Early automobiles used ''sliding-mesh'' manual transmissions with up to three forward gear ratios. Since the 1950s, ''constant-mesh'' manual transmissions have become increasingly commonplace and the number of forward ratios has increased to 5-speed and 6-speed manual transmissions for current vehicles. ZF Friedrichshafen
ZF Friedrichshafen AG, also known as ZF Group, originally ''Zahnradfabrik Friedrichshafen'', and commonly abbreviated to ZF (ZF = "Zahnradfabrik" = "Cogwheel Factory"), is a German car parts maker headquartered in Friedrichshafen, in the south-west German state of Baden-Württemberg. Specialising in engineering, it is primarily known for its design, research and development, and manufacturing activities in the automotive industry. It is a worldwide supplier of driveline and chassis technology for cars and commercial vehicles, along with specialist plant equipment such as construction equipment. It is also involved in rail, marine, defense and aviation industries, as well as general industrial applications. ZF has 241 production locations in 41 countries with approximately 148,000 (2019) employees. Rear Mid-engine, Rear-wheel-drive Layout
In automotive design, an RMR, or rear mid-engine, rear-wheel-drive layout is one in which the rear wheels are driven by an engine placed with its center of gravity in front of the rear axle, and thus right behind the passenger compartment. Nowadays more frequently called 'RMR', to acknowledge that certain sporty or performance focused front-engined cars are also "mid-engined", by having the main engine mass behind the front axle, RMR layout cars were previously (until ca. the 1990) just called MR, or mid-engine, rear-wheel-drive layout), because the nuance between distinctly front-engined vs. front ''mid-engined'' cars often remained undiscussed. In contrast to the fully rear-engine, rear-wheel-drive layout, the center of mass of the engine is in front of the rear axle. This layout is typically chosen for its favorable weight distribution.
